Public Works cancels unlawful Cat Matlala-linked hospital lease

- Advertisement -spot_img

Must read

By Thapelo Molefe

Public Works and Infrastructure Minister Dean Macpherson has terminated a lease agreement with Medicare 24 Tshwane District, a company linked to controversial businessman Vusimuzi “Cat” Matlala, after an internal investigation found that the deal could not legally take effect and may have bypassed basic governance requirements.

The lease, concluded in December 2023, relates to a hospital facility in Pretoria West and was cancelled with immediate effect on Friday, following mounting allegations aired in Parliament and detailed by a South African media investigation.

At the centre of the matter is a critical procedural failure: the property was never declared surplus by the South African Police Service (SAPS), which remains the lawful designated user of the facility under the Government Immovable Asset Management Act of 2007.

Without such a declaration, any lease agreement is legally invalid.
